#218bc3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#218bc3 is composed of 12.9% red, 54.5%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 28.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 200.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 44.7%. #218bc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#001787.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#218bc3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#218bc3 has RGB values of R:33, G:139,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2198467.

Shades and Tints of #218bc3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070a is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#218bc3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707374 is the less saturated color, while #0793dd is the most saturated one.
